How to prepare for a job interview at Crash Media Group

Know Your Content Inside Out

Before the interview, dive deep into the company's existing content. Familiarise yourself with their style, tone, and the types of articles they publish in sports and auto. This will not only show your genuine interest but also help you discuss how you can enhance their editorial strategy.

Showcase Your Leadership Skills

Prepare examples from your past experiences where you've successfully led editorial teams. Highlight specific challenges you faced and how you overcame them. This will demonstrate your capability to manage and inspire a team effectively.

SEO Savvy is Key

Brush up on your SEO knowledge and be ready to discuss how you’ve implemented SEO strategies in your previous roles. Bring examples of how your SEO expertise has improved content visibility and engagement, as this is crucial for the role.

Ask Insightful Questions

Prepare thoughtful questions about the company’s future direction, content strategy, and team dynamics. This shows that you’re not just interested in the position but are also thinking about how you can contribute to their long-term goals.
